Understanding the Foundation: HTML, CSS, and JavaScript
To master web development, you must start with a strong foundation. HTML (Hypertext Markup Language), CSS (Cascading Style Sheets), and JavaScript form the core of web development. HTML is used to structure the content on web pages, CSS is for styling and layout, and JavaScript is for adding interactivity and functionality.
- HTML (Hypertext Markup Language): HTML is the backbone of web development. It provides the structure of a web page, defining headings, paragraphs, lists, links, and other elements. Learning HTML is relatively easy, and there are numerous online resources and tutorials available. However, mastering it requires understanding the semantic use of HTML tags and how to create well-structured documents.
- CSS (Cascading Style Sheets): CSS is used to control the visual presentation of web pages. This includes defining fonts, colors, layouts, and responsive design. A deep understanding of CSS is essential for creating visually appealing and user-friendly websites. Understanding CSS frameworks, such as Bootstrap or Foundation, can also be highly beneficial.
- JavaScript: JavaScript is a dynamic scripting language that adds interactivity to web pages. It is used for creating animations, handling user input, and making web applications more responsive. Learning JavaScript is a significant step in mastering web development, as it allows you to create dynamic and engaging web experiences.
Responsive Web Design
In the era of smartphones and tablets, it’s crucial to create websites that look and function well on various devices and screen sizes. Responsive web design is the approach that ensures your web pages adapt to different devices and screen resolutions.
- Media Queries: Media queries in CSS are used to define different styles for different screen sizes. Learning how to use media queries effectively is essential for responsive web design.
- Mobile-First Design: Embracing a mobile-first approach means designing for mobile devices first and then scaling up to larger screens. This approach ensures that your website is optimized for mobile users.
Web Development Frameworks and Libraries
To speed up development and enhance the functionality of web applications, web developers often turn to frameworks and libraries. These tools provide pre-built components and functions that can save time and effort.
- Front-End Frameworks: Front-end frameworks like React, Angular, and Vue.js simplify the development of interactive user interfaces. These frameworks offer reusable components and help you build single-page applications (SPAs) efficiently.
- Back-End Frameworks: Back-end frameworks like Express (for Node.js), Ruby on Rails, and Django (for Python) provide a structured way to build server-side logic and handle databases. They often come with authentication, routing, and database management built in.
Version Control and Collaboration
Web development is rarely a solitary endeavor. It often involves collaboration with other developers, designers, and stakeholders. Version control and collaboration tools are crucial for working on projects as a team.
- Git and GitHub: Git is a distributed version control system that allows you to track changes in your code, collaborate with others, and manage different versions of your project. GitHub, a web-based platform, is widely used for hosting Git repositories and collaborating on open-source projects.
Performance Optimization
Website performance is a critical aspect of web development. Users expect fast-loading pages, and search engines favor well-optimized sites. To master web development, you must be proficient in performance optimization techniques.
- Page Speed Optimization: Techniques like image optimization, minification of CSS and JavaScript files, and reducing server response times are crucial for improving page load times.
- Caching: Implementing browser caching and server-side caching mechanisms can significantly enhance website performance.
Security Best Practices
With the increasing frequency of cyberattacks and data breaches, web security is of paramount importance. Mastering web development includes understanding and implementing security best practices.
- HTTPS: Using HTTPS to encrypt data transmitted between the user’s browser and your web server is a fundamental security measure.
- Input Validation: Validating user inputs on the server-side to prevent malicious data from being processed is a crucial security practice.
-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) and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) Prevention: Familiarize yourself with these common web vulnerabilities and how to prevent them.
Testing and Debugging
A proficient web developer should be skilled in testing and debugging their code to ensure that everything functions as intended.
- Browser Developer Tools: Familiarize yourself with the developer tools available in web browsers, which are invaluable for debugging and inspecting web pages.
- Testing Frameworks: Using testing frameworks like Jest for JavaScript or Pytest for Python can help automate the testing process and ensure that your code functions correctly.
